Remote Elevator roles focus on maintaining and troubleshooting elevator systems remotely, requiring technical certifications and working within building management environments. In contrast, Remote Security Guards monitor security systems and respond to incidents virtually, emphasizing surveillance skills and security training. Both roles are vital for property safety and rely on remote monitoring technology, but they serve different operational functions within the industry.

Company Overview:We have a vision – to have a MAD product in every elevator. Headquartered in Mississauga Canada, our 80,000 sq. foot facility focuses on the efficient production of industry-leading fixtures, high quality elevator car interiors, and cutting-edge digital products.
At MAD, we set you up to be the expert – providing the tools, support, and environment to help you thrive. From there, it’s all you – your drive and ideas lead the way. MAD has been ranked among Canada's top 500 fastest growing companies, one of Canada’s Best Managed Companies, a Best Places to Work in Canada, and among Best Employers for Recent Graduates.
Our New Senior Software Developer:As a Senior Software Developer, you will work with other developers to create and maintain software, tools, and infrastructure for web applications, services, and IoT devices.
The ideal candidate is a skilled problem solver and quick learner who takes a proactive approach to improving quality, demonstrates meticulous attention to detail, and treats software development like a craft. Software development is more than a job; it is a genuine passion and an integral part of their identity.
